You are booking hotel for more than 30 days
Select Filters
Your Budget
Locality
Popular locations
Show -3 more
Showing Properties in David
Hotel Castilla
Based on 165 Ratings and 0 reviews
(165 Ratings)
THB 1,634
THB 1,512
+ THB 303 taxes & fees
Per Night
Gran Hotel Nacional
Based on 471 Ratings and 0 reviews
(471 Ratings)
THB 2,776
THB 2,568
+ THB 519 taxes & fees
Per Night
Hotel Iberia
THB 2,251
+ THB 225 taxes & fees
Per Night
Hotel F Sur Inn
Based on 67 Ratings and 0 reviews
(67 Ratings)
THB 2,228
THB 2,061
+ THB 401 taxes & fees
Per Night
Aranjuez Hotel & Suites
THB 2,431
+ THB 243 taxes & fees
Per Night
Hampton by Hilton David
Based on 304 Ratings and 0 reviews
(304 Ratings)
THB 2,638
+ THB 235 taxes & fees
Per Night
Get min. 15% OFF on international hotels with special bank offers.